全面战争MOD开发新纪元:RPFM如何让复杂游戏数据编辑变得简单高效
全面战争MOD开发新纪元RPFM如何让复杂游戏数据编辑变得简单高效【免费下载链接】rpfmRusted PackFile Manager (RPFM) is a... reimplementation in Rust and Qt6 of PackFile Manager (PFM), one of the best modding tools for Total War Games.项目地址: https://gitcode.com/gh_mirrors/rp/rpfm你是否曾因《全面战争》MOD开发中数万行数据表格的卡顿而抓狂是否在复杂的文件依赖关系中迷失方向是否对重复的翻译工作感到厌倦RPFMRusted PackFile Manager作为一款基于Rust和Qt6重构的现代化MOD开发工具正在彻底改变全面战争系列游戏的MOD开发体验。传统MOD开发的三大痛点与RPFM的解决方案痛点一海量数据处理的效率瓶颈传统MOD工具在处理《全面战争》庞大的游戏数据时打开一个包含5万行数据的表格可能需要等待30秒以上每次搜索都要忍受漫长的响应时间。更糟糕的是内存占用常常超过1GB让普通配置的电脑不堪重负。RPFM的智能解决方案采用增量渲染技术和分页加载算法将5万行表格的加载时间缩短到5秒以内内存占用降低70%以上。智能缓存机制确保频繁访问的数据即时可用让数据编辑从此告别卡顿。痛点二依赖管理的混乱迷宫MOD开发中最令人头疼的问题莫过于文件依赖关系。一个简单的单位修改可能涉及数十个相关文件传统工具缺乏可视化依赖分析开发者只能凭经验猜测常常导致游戏崩溃或MOD冲突。RPFM的可视化依赖管理自动构建文件依赖图谱清晰展示每个数据表、资源文件之间的引用关系。循环引用检测功能提前预警潜在冲突让依赖管理从猜谜游戏变成清晰导航。痛点三重复劳动的效率陷阱本地化翻译、批量修改、格式转换等重复性工作占据了MOD开发者大量时间。传统工具缺乏自动化处理能力每个修改都需要手动操作效率低下且容易出错。RPFM的自动化工作流内置批量处理引擎支持正则表达式高级搜索替换翻译记忆库确保术语一致性智能格式转换自动处理特殊字符和编码问题将重复劳动时间减少80%以上。RPFM主界面左侧文件树、中间表格预览、底部诊断面板的清晰布局核心功能深度解析从数据编辑到资源管理的全面革新数据表格编辑百万级数据的流畅操作体验RPFM的数据库表格编辑器重新定义了游戏数据编辑的标准。支持《全面战争》系列所有版本的数据表格式无论是单位属性、技能效果还是建筑链配置都能轻松应对。核心特性亮点智能筛选系统支持正则表达式和多重条件组合过滤快速定位目标数据批量操作引擎一键修改多行数据支持跨表格数据同步实时错误检测自动标记数据类型不匹配和格式错误历史版本管理操作记录可追溯随时撤销或重做修改数据库表格编辑直观的表格界面支持快速筛选和批量编辑实用操作技巧使用^unit_.*正则表达式快速查找所有单位相关字段利用db/.*_tables/批量修改路径前缀通过空值检测功能^\s*$快速定位缺失数据本地化文本管理国际化工作的智能化助手翻译工作不再是MOD开发的噩梦。RPFM的本地化工具提供了完整的翻译工作流支持从术语管理到格式保护再到团队协作每个环节都经过精心优化。工作流优化术语一致性维护系统自动记忆翻译选择确保整个MOD术语统一格式保护机制正确处理XML标签和变量占位符避免格式破坏团队协作支持支持JSON、CSV等多种格式导出方便翻译分工本地化文本编辑支持颜色标记和格式保护的文本编辑界面3D资源编辑从肖像设置到模型优化的完整工具链RPFM提供了完整的3D资源编辑能力覆盖从角色肖像到复杂模型的各个环节。肖像设置精确控制3D视角参数调整Yaw、Pitch、Field of View参数精确到小数点后两位材质路径管理Diffuse和Mask贴图路径批量配置实时预览功能调整参数即时查看效果无需反复测试肖像设置编辑精确控制角色头像的相机角度和材质参数刚体模型深度编辑多层级LOD管理支持Lod 0到Lod 2的层级设置优化游戏性能纹理路径配置直接编辑ODIFFUSE、BASE_COLOR等纹理路径模型参数调整可见距离、质量等级等参数精确控制刚体模型编辑详细的模型层级和纹理映射管理界面动画与资源包管理可视化操作提升效率动画资源管理变得前所未有的简单。通过直观的双面板界面你可以轻松管理动画包和资源包之间的文件关系支持拖拽操作和批量处理。效率提升点双向拖拽操作直接在资源包和动画包之间移动文件结构清晰展示层级化展示文件关系避免混乱批量处理支持支持整个文件夹的导入导出操作实战案例6小时完成《战锤3》混沌恶魔单位MOD开发让我们通过一个具体案例看看RPFM如何将原本需要3-4天的开发工作压缩到6小时以内。第一阶段数据表配置2小时在db/land_units_tables中添加新单位时RPFM的智能筛选功能让我们能快速定位相关字段。批量复制相似单位的配置模板将原本需要逐项填写的工作简化为模板化操作。使用正则表达式^unit_.*快速筛选所有单位相关字段效率提升300%。第二阶段本地化处理1.5小时在text/db_units.loc中添加单位名称和描述时翻译记忆库自动推荐相似术语确保翻译一致性。格式保护机制自动处理特殊字符避免因格式错误导致的游戏崩溃。导出翻译文件供团队校对协作效率提升200%。第三阶段动画与肖像配置2小时在动画片段编辑器中配置单位动作时可视化界面让骨骼类型和ID范围设置变得直观。肖像设置工具实时预览功能让我们能即时查看调整效果无需反复进入游戏测试测试次数减少80%。第四阶段质量保证0.5小时运行完整诊断检查自动检测文件依赖关系和潜在冲突。设置父包依赖关系确保MOD兼容性。最终测试一次通过避免了传统方法中常见的反复调试。学习路径从新手到专家的成长指南第一周基础掌握阶段目标熟悉RPFM界面和基本操作任务清单完成RPFM安装和初始配置学习打开和浏览Pack文件尝试简单的表格数据编辑运行第一次诊断检查导出第一个修改测试第二至四周技能提升阶段目标掌握核心功能和工作流任务清单深入学习数据库表格编辑技巧掌握本地化文本管理流程学习动画包和资源包管理实践肖像设置和模型编辑理解文件依赖关系管理第二至三个月专家精通阶段目标成为高效MOD开发专家任务清单精通正则表达式高级应用掌握自动化脚本和批量处理优化团队协作工作流参与社区贡献和工具优化开发自定义工具插件今日行动清单立即开始你的高效MOD开发之旅第一步环境准备15分钟从项目仓库获取RPFM最新版本解压文件到合适目录运行RPFM完成初始配置第二步基础学习30分钟打开一个现有MOD作为学习参考浏览文件结构和数据组织方式尝试简单的数据查看和筛选操作第三步实战操作45分钟选择一个简单的数据表进行编辑练习尝试使用正则表达式进行数据筛选运行诊断检查理解错误提示导出修改并测试效果第四步深入学习持续进行阅读官方文档了解高级功能加入社区讨论获取实践经验尝试更复杂的MOD开发项目分享你的经验帮助其他开发者资源导航高效学习的正确路径核心文档资源快速入门指南docs/intro/what-is-rpfm.md - 了解RPFM基本概念和工作原理数据库编辑教程docs/editors/db.md - 掌握表格编辑的核心技巧本地化处理指南docs/editors/loc.md - 学习文本翻译的最佳实践动画包管理手册docs/editors/animpack.md - 理解动画资源的管理方法肖像设置教程docs/editors/portrait-settings.md - 掌握角色肖像的配置技巧实用工具资源诊断工具使用docs/search/diagnostics.md - 学习如何发现和修复问题全局搜索技巧docs/search/global-search.md - 掌握高效搜索方法参考管理系统docs/search/references.md - 理解文件引用关系管理进阶学习资源架构优化指南docs/tutorials/optimising-a-mod.md - 学习MOD性能优化数据核心教程docs/tutorials/datacores.md - 深入理解游戏数据架构翻译工作流docs/tutorials/translating-a-mod.md - 掌握多语言MOD开发结语开启你的MOD开发效率革命RPFM不仅仅是一个工具升级更是MOD开发思维方式的革新。它将复杂的数据管理转化为直观的可视化操作将重复的人工劳动升级为智能化的自动处理。无论你是独立开发者还是团队协作这款由Rust驱动的高效工具都将为你的创作注入新的活力。现在就行动起来用RPFM开启你的高效MOD开发之旅。你会发现原来《全面战争》MOD开发可以如此简单、快速、高效。从今天开始让RPFM成为你最强大的创作伙伴将更多时间投入到创意实现而不是繁琐的技术细节中。【免费下载链接】rpfmRusted PackFile Manager (RPFM) is a... reimplementation in Rust and Qt6 of PackFile Manager (PFM), one of the best modding tools for Total War Games.项目地址: https://gitcode.com/gh_mirrors/rp/rpfm创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考